Colored image of two horse-drawn coaches with many passengers riding down a dirt road. In the background are buildings and utility poles. Caption reads, “Tally Ho Stage, used only in the White Mountains of New Hampshire.”
Back Description: Typical postcard back. Features a handwritten note, postmark, and postage stamp.
Transcription: "This morning it was ten above and the wind stil blowing. Has warmed up some and the sun is shining. We have two of these old stage coaches that run to the depots from the hotels, can carry about eighteen or twenty people."
